Course Description

Lakeside Golf Club operates as a full 18-hole public golf course located on Shediac Road in Moncton, New Brunswick. The club serves the Moncton golfing community with year-round activities including memberships, tournaments, golf lessons, and on-site facilities such as a pro shop and club repair services. It is home to Alfred's 19th Hole and has been serving the local golf community since 1928. The venue offers a public course experience with various facilities and events for players of all levels.

How difficult is Lakeside Golf Club for mid-handicap golfers?

Players often find Lakeside Golf Club technically exacting. A slope rating of 130.0 suggests a moderately demanding round. The course rating of 71.2 reflects on scoring relative to par 70.

What tees should a 15 handicap play at Lakeside Golf Club?

A 15 handicap golfer should consider tees closer to 5928 yards. The back tees extend to 6744.0 yards, which makes approach shots longer and scoring more challenging.

What is considered a good score at Lakeside Golf Club?

With a course rating of 71.2 and par 70, a mid-handicap golfer would typically score in the mid to high 80s. Stronger players aiming to break 70 must manage approach shots and avoid penalty strokes.
